Liverpool XI vs Tottenham: Confirmed team news, starting lineup, latest injury list for Premier League today

 (ES Composite)
(ES Composite)

Liverpool could be boosted by the return of Jordan Henderson for tonight’s huge clash with Tottenham after the skipper returned to training this week.

Henderson, and Joel Matip, missed Sunday's FA Cup defeat to Manchester United, but their possible return will boost Jurgen Klopp's defensive options for the challenge of facing Harry Kane and Heung-min Son.

"Hendo and Joel trained yesterday with the team fully," Klopp said.

"Always with these things we have to wait and see how they reacted overnight - but they trained yesterday."

With Thursday's gave a third of seven across 22 days, Henderson is unlikely to be rushed back despite his muscle injury deemed minor.

Naby Keita, Diogo Jota, Joe Gomez and Virgil van Dijk remain on the treatment table.

Thiago Alcantara and Gini Wijnaldum, after being withdrawn against United, should line up in midfield with Henderson. Xherdan Shaqiri and Alex Oxlade-Chamberlain fighting for the third spot in the three should Henderson not be able to start.

Sadio Mane was rested from the starting line-up against United, but should be restored alongside Roberto Firmino and Mohamed Salah.

Liverpool predicted XI (4-3-3): Alisson, Alexander-Arnold, Matip, Fabinho, Robertson, Wijnaldum, Thiago, Menderson, Salah, Firmino, Mane

Injury list: Jota (knee), Van Dijk (knee), Gomez (knee), Keita (knock)

Doubts: Henderson, Matip
